How To Cook Quinoa

The first important step for this recipe is to cook the quinoa. So, I thought I would quickly go over how to do so for those who have never made quinoa before (or for those who simply want a refresher). The steps are very easy and also quite similar to how you would cook rice or oatmeal. For this recipe, I cooked my quinoa on the stovetop. However, I have also made it in my Dash rice cooker many times. Since I know that not everyone has a rice cooker, I am going to discuss how to make your quinoa on the stovetop. The following are the essential steps:

Step 1 – Add the quinoa to a pot with water (follow package directions for ratio).
Step 2 – Place the pot on the stovetop with the lid, and bring to a boil.
Step 3 – Turn the heat to medium-low and cook until the quinoa is fluffy and soft, about 10 – 15 minutes.

And that’s it. As you can tell, the steps to making quinoa are very quick and simple. I always make sure to watch my quinoa closely while it cooks to ensure it doesn’t burn. It cooks much faster than brown rice, and I pull it off from the heat right when it gets fluffy and all the water is absorbed. How To Make A Cilantro Lime Quinoa Bowl

Another common question relating to this recipe is how to use your cilantro lime quinoa in a nourish or burrito bowl. This is actually quite easy to do. Essentially, you use the cilantro lime quinoa as a base, and then add in whatever you’d like. I personally love to add black beans, cooked tofu, veggies such as broccoli and corn, fresh tomatoes, avocado, salsa, nutritional yeast seasoning, etc.

Pretty much anything you would normally put inside a burrito can go into your nourish bowl. All of these flavors pair perfectly with the cilantro lime quinoa, so it is a delicious combination that I highly recommend. Cilantro Lime Quinoa

Easy Cilantro Lime Quinoa

Alyssa Atkinson
A simple and delicious cilantro lime quinoa recipe that tastes great in salads, burritos, nourish bowls, and more.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 3
Calories 130 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1/2 cup dry quinoa
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ro (finely chopped)
  • salt to taste
  • 1 cup water
  • 1/2 tbsp freshly squeezed lime juice
  • 1/2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il

Instructions
 

  • Add the quinoa and water to a pot.
  • Cover the pot with the lid and bring the mixture to a boil.
  • Turn the heat to medium-low and cook the quinoa until it is soft, fluffy, and all the water is absorbed, about 10 – 15 minutes.
  • Remove the quinoa from heat, then transfer it to a large mixing bowl.
  • Add in the lime juice and olive oil, and mix well to combine.
  • Add the salt to taste, then mix again.
  • Gently fold in the fresh chopped cilantro.
